Marco Luka’s Protect: A Lyrical Dive Into Vulnerable Love

By Marcus AdetolaOctober 7, 2023
Marco Luka's Protect: A Lyrical Dive into Vulnerable Love
photo credit Nick Dybel

Marco Luka, the captivating voice behind Weston Estate, has recently dropped his latest solo single, protect. It’s an intimate dive into love’s complexities. The combination of delicate guitar strums with Luka’s vocals effortlessly transitions from the depths of vulnerability to soaring heights of passion, capturing sentiments of love and the intricacies of human connection.

The lyrics of protect paint a poignant picture of two lovers trapped in a dance of fear and longing. The opening verse, “I can take the world from you, oh / And you can take the world from me,” sets the stage for a tale of love that’s both comforting and confining. The chorus, with its haunting repetition of “I want you,” is a heart-wrenching cry for connection amidst the chaos of change.

The accompanying music video, directed by the talented CQ, adds another layer to the narrative.

As the lead single from his upcoming EP INSOMNIA, protect offers an exciting glimpse into what’s to come.

In his own words, Luka describes protect as a song about two lovers staying together out of fear of being misunderstood. It’s a sentiment that resonates, especially in a world where true connection often feels elusive. The song’s closing lines, “Cause it hurts for me to tell you, ‘I don’t love you anymore'”, are a stark reminder of the fragility of love and the courage it takes to let go.

Protect is a song that invites listeners to reflect, to feel, and most importantly, to connect.
